Bench warrant issued for Delta Force escapees

The Ashanti Regional Police Command has issued a bench warrant for 13 members of vigilante group Delta Force who were set free from a Kumasi Circuit Court on Thursday.

The 13 were standing trial for assaulting the newly appointed Ashanti Regional Security Coordinator, George Adjei, on Friday, March 24, 2017.

But on Thursday when they were remanded in prison custody, other members of the New Patriotic Party-affiliated vigilante group who had apparently come to the court in solidarity with their arrested colleagues defied the judge’s orders and asked the accused to follow them home.

They used “the back door” which was reserved only for judges. According to the Public Relations Officer of the Command, ASP Yaw Nketia-Yeboah, eight of the Delta Force members who aided the escape of their friends were arrested “and they are in police custody”.

For the 13 who are at large, the bench warrant is over their heads, he said. The police say it is unclear whether the eight arrested are members of the vigilante group.

He said they will be arraigned before court in no time.
